General annotation (Comments)
| Function | Catalyzes the dephosphorylation of undecaprenyl diphosphate (UPP). Confers resistance to bacitracin By similarity. HAMAP-Rule MF_01006 |
| Catalytic activity | Ditrans,octacis-undecaprenyl diphosphate + H2O = ditrans,octacis-undecaprenyl phosphate + phosphate. HAMAP-Rule MF_01006 |
| Subcellular location | Cell membrane; Multi-pass membrane protein By similarity HAMAP-Rule MF_01006. |
| Miscellaneous | Bacitracin is thought to be involved in the inhibition of peptidoglycan synthesis by sequestering undecaprenyl diphosphate, thereby reducing the pool of lipid carrier available. HAMAP-Rule MF_01006 |
| Sequence similarities | Belongs to the UppP family. |
